Common Namedzununcanone
DescriptionDzununcanone belongs to the class of organic compounds known as 16-oxosteroids. These are steroid derivatives carrying a C=O group at the 16-position of the steroid skeleton. dzununcanone is found in Semialarium mexicanum. dzununcanone was first documented in 2007 (PMID: 17385912). Based on a literature review very few articles have been published on dzununcanone.
